The Pain Waves podcast by Pain BC is where you can hear leading chronic pain experts and people living with pain discuss the latest pain management research, tools, stories, and trends.

Pain BC is a registered health charity that has been leading efforts to improve the lives of people in pain through empowerment, care, education and innovation. Learn more at painbc.ca.

Paving the path towards painless patient engagement
Not long ago, researchers would only involve people with lived experience in their work as research participants. Nowadays, patient engagement has become an essential part of the research process, but many researchers are unfamiliar with how to incorporate the patient perspective.  


On this episode of the Pain Waves podcast, we’re joined by Dawn Richards, the Director of Patient and Public Engagement at Clinical Trials Ontario, and Linda Hunter, a semi-retired nurse and health care executive. Both live with chronic pain and are involved in patient engagement in research. With a panel of patient partners and the Institute of Musculoskeletal Health and Arthritis, they have developed a course breaking down how to do patient engagement in research.
